lp:~zorba-coders/zorba/xml-in-json-indices
Created by
Ghislain Fourny
and last modified
- Get this branch:
- bzr branch lp:~zorba-coders/zorba/xml-in-json-indices
Members of
Zorba Coders
can upload to this branch. Log in for directions.
Branch merges
Propose for merging
No branches
dependent on this one.
- Paul J. Lucas: Approve
- Till Westmann: Approve
- Matthias Brantner: Approve
- Markos Zaharioudakis: Approve
-
Diff: 4187 lines (+1673/-1025)37 files modifiedsrc/runtime/collections/collections_impl.cpp (+2/-2)
src/runtime/json/json_constructors.cpp (+1/-1)
src/runtime/json/jsoniq_functions_impl.cpp (+5/-5)
src/store/api/item.h (+44/-29)
src/store/naive/CMakeLists.txt (+25/-23)
src/store/naive/collection.cpp (+25/-16)
src/store/naive/collection.h (+23/-37)
src/store/naive/collection_tree_info.h (+194/-0)
src/store/naive/item.cpp (+1/-1)
src/store/naive/json_items.cpp (+163/-170)
src/store/naive/json_items.h (+46/-92)
src/store/naive/loader_dtd.cpp (+2/-3)
src/store/naive/loader_fast.cpp (+2/-1)
src/store/naive/node_items.cpp (+121/-50)
src/store/naive/node_items.h (+121/-76)
src/store/naive/pul_primitives.cpp (+6/-16)
src/store/naive/simple_collection.cpp (+322/-326)
src/store/naive/simple_collection.h (+60/-25)
src/store/naive/simple_collection_set.h (+9/-14)
src/store/naive/simple_item_factory.cpp (+1/-1)
src/store/naive/simple_pul.cpp (+44/-91)
src/store/naive/simple_store.cpp (+14/-10)
src/store/naive/store.cpp (+22/-19)
src/store/naive/store_defs.h (+18/-16)
src/store/naive/structured_item.cpp (+144/-0)
src/store/naive/structured_item.h (+93/-0)
src/types/typeops.cpp (+1/-1)
test/rbkt/ExpQueryResults/zorba/jsoniq/collection-and-index/foaf-json-xml-index-point-maintenance.xml.res (+1/-0)
test/rbkt/ExpQueryResults/zorba/jsoniq/collection-and-index/foaf-json-xml-index-point.xml.res (+1/-0)
test/rbkt/ExpQueryResults/zorba/jsoniq/collection-and-index/foaf-json-xml-update-index-point.xml.res (+1/-0)
test/rbkt/Queries/zorba/jsoniq/collection-and-index/foaf-json-xml-index-point-maintenance.spec (+1/-0)
test/rbkt/Queries/zorba/jsoniq/collection-and-index/foaf-json-xml-index-point-maintenance.xq (+36/-0)
test/rbkt/Queries/zorba/jsoniq/collection-and-index/foaf-json-xml-index-point.spec (+1/-0)
test/rbkt/Queries/zorba/jsoniq/collection-and-index/foaf-json-xml-index-point.xq (+15/-0)
test/rbkt/Queries/zorba/jsoniq/collection-and-index/foaf-json-xml-update-index-point.spec (+1/-0)
test/rbkt/Queries/zorba/jsoniq/collection-and-index/foaf-json-xml-update-index-point.xq (+25/-0)
test/rbkt/Queries/zorba/jsoniq/collection-and-index/foaf_module-with-index-and-xml.xqlib (+82/-0)
Branch information
Recent revisions
- 11056. By Markos Zaharioudakis
-
renamed Item::isRoot() to isCollectionRoot() + commented and renamed CollectionTreeInfo classes
Branch metadata
- Branch format:
- Branch format 7
- Repository format:
- Bazaar repository format 2a (needs bzr 1.16 or later)
- Stacked on:
- lp:zorba